Job Description
Key Accountabilities (results expected to achieve) : Ensures timely completion of First Article Inspection Reports per customer requirements. Key Responsibilities (tasks that you do to achieve the accountabilities) : Ensures company standards for safety, quality and customer satisfaction are met or exceeded. Performs First Article Inspections and prepares First Article Reports CMM experience with Creaform Scanner & FARO Arm inspection equipment using Polyworks measuring software. Experience with hand tools and measurement equipment, included but not limited to caliper, micrometer, surface plate, height gauges, force gauges and pull testers required. Reads and interprets drawings with GD&T dimensioning and Acceptance criteria specifications. Perform statistical studies as needed (Cpk/Gage R & R), Statistical Process Control (SPC) inspections and prepare reports, charts, etc. Assists as needed with document preparation for Production Part Approval Process (PPAP) submissions. Maintains inspection records according to company & customer standards. Assists Quality Engineers and Inspectors in developing or modifying inspection procedures as needed. Assists Engineering with inspection fixture designs. Communicates effectively amongst a cross-functional team of Inspectors, Operators, Engineers, and Technicians Helps train Quality Auditors how to read drawings and proper use of inspection equipment.
